### Release Pipeline

Every release follows this pipeline in strict order:

1. **Build** -- Verify a clean, reproducible build for all target platforms.
2. **Test** -- Confirm QA sign-off, quality gates met, no S1/S2 bugs.
   - Before requesting QA sign-off, run `mcp__gitnexus__detect_changes` with `scope: "compare"` and `base_ref: "main"` to produce the list of affected execution flows. Attach this to the QA request so `qa-engineer` can target regression testing precisely.
3. **Cert** -- Submit to platform certification, track feedback, iterate.
4. **Submit** -- Upload final build to storefronts, configure release settings.
5. **Verify** -- Download and test the store build on real hardware.
6. **Launch** -- Flip the switch at the agreed time, monitor first-hour metrics.

No step may be skipped. If a step fails, the pipeline halts and the issue is
resolved before proceeding.

### Platform Certification Requirements

- **Console certification**: Follow each platform holder's Technical
  Requirements Checklist (TRC/TCR/Lotcheck). Track every requirement
  individually with pass/fail/not-applicable status.
- **Store guidelines**: Ensure compliance with each storefront's content
  policies, metadata requirements, screenshot specifications, and age rating
  obligations.
- **PC storefronts**: Verify DRM configuration, cloud save compatibility,
  achievement integration, and controller support declarations.
- **Mobile stores**: Validate permissions declarations, privacy policy links,
  data safety disclosures, and content rating questionnaires.

### Version Numbering

Use semantic versioning: `MAJOR.MINOR.PATCH`

- **MAJOR**: Significant content additions or breaking changes (expansion,
  sequel-level update)
- **MINOR**: Feature additions, content updates, balance passes
- **PATCH**: Bug fixes, hotfixes, minor adjustments

Internal build numbers use the format: `MAJOR.MINOR.PATCH.BUILD` where BUILD
is an auto-incrementing integer from the build system.

Version tags must be applied to the git repository at every release point.

### Store Page Management

Maintain and track the following for each storefront:

- **Description text**: Short description, long description, feature list
- **Media assets**: Screenshots (per platform resolution requirements),
  trailers, key art, capsule images
- **Metadata**: Genre tags, controller support, language support, system
  requirements, content descriptors
- **Age ratings**: ESRB, PEGI, USK, CERO, GRAC, ClassInd as applicable.
  Track questionnaire submissions and certificate receipt.
- **Legal**: EULA, privacy policy, third-party license attributions
